Long-captive green turtle released in Florida Keys National Marine Sanctuary

Florida Keys National Marine Sanctuary Superintendent Sarah Fangman (top left) and Florida Fish and Wildlife Conservation Commissioner Robert Spottwood (top right) on Friday met a long-captive green turtle named Beckett as he was transferred from truck to boat at Key West City Marina. Fitted with a tracking device, he was released in the sanctuary by the FWC Sea Turtle Program and Miami Seaquarium. Photo: Meghan Koperski/FWC
